Welcoming the PM at the airport, Mandalay Region Chief Minister, U Ye Myint, said he believes the visit will strengthen traditional relations between the two countries and deepen bilateral cooperation.
He said the Mandalay region is willing to create the most favourable conditions for Vietnamese and Myanmar businesses to seek cooperation in agriculture, mining, industry, and tourism.
PM Dung expressed his pleasure at visiting Myanmar’s cultural and tourism centre for the first time, saying that Vietnam always respects the traditional relationship with Myanmar. He also thanked the Myanmar government and people for their assistance to Vietnam during its past struggle for national independence and its current process of national development.
He highly valued the positive bilateral cooperation between the two countries, saying it not only benefits Vietnamese businesses, but also contribute to Myanmar’s development.
In the evening, Myanmar President Thein Sein held a banquet in honour of PM Dung and his entourage.
